Camcas wrote:Brook and Afolabi should be higher and Simpson lower. Apart from that good list :TU:
Brook's level of opposition has been disappointing, he hasn't fought at European level yet so he doesn't really deserve to be any higher. If he beats Jackiewicz he might enter the top 10.

Afolabi has just been having keep busy fights recently, so I don't think he should be in the top 10 until he starts fighting against a higher level of competition.

I thought Simpson was unlucky not to get the decision in the two Smith fights and he has beaten Lindsay within the last 12 months as well.
